Europe and the Czechs was an influential and widely read Penguin Special written by female journalist Shiela Grant Duff during the appeasement of the second world war. It was published on the day British prime minister Chamberlain returned from Munich in which he pressured Czechoslovakia to cede territory to Nazi Germany, and it was distributed to every member of parliament. In her book she defended the Czech nation and criticized British policy, claiming that war could be an option if it were necessary to confront Hitler's aggresion in Czechia. She argued against the policy of "peace at almost any price", albeit without using the word "appeasement".
